FSU Basketball and the National Championships

The Florida State Seminoles have never won an NCAA National Championship in basketball. Despite their long and storied history, the Seminoles have never been able to break through and win a title. This is despite the fact that the Seminoles have had outstanding teams over the years, with some of the best players in college basketball.

Closest FSU Has Come to a National Championship

The closest the Florida State Seminoles have come to winning a National Championship was in 1972. Led by All-American Ron King, the Seminoles reached the Final Four for the first time in school history. They were defeated by the eventual champions, the UCLA Bruins, in the semi-finals.
